About this banknote
The Bank of Guatemala issued the 5 quetzales banknote (Pick 116) on March 12, 2008. This series was printed by François-Charles Oberthur Fiduciaire in France.
The obverse features a portrait of General Justo Rufino Barrios, President of Guatemala from 1873 to 1885. The reverse depicts an illustration of a classroom. The banknote measures 151 x 67 mm.
